Core Viewpoint - The recent incidents of two American citizens being shot by immigration enforcement officers in Minneapolis have sparked widespread protests and political tensions, highlighting the ongoing conflict between local and federal authorities regarding immigration enforcement policies [3][6]. Group 1: Incidents and Reactions - On January 7, 2023, Good was shot by enforcement officers during a large-scale immigration operation in Minneapolis, which was described as the "largest ever" by the Department of Homeland Security [4]. - Good was reported to have been shot at least three times, with the incident being characterized differently by local and federal authorities, leading to accusations of misconduct against the enforcement officers involved [5]. - The death of Good ignited nationwide protests, with thousands demanding the abolition of ICE (Immigration and Customs Enforcement) and leading to confrontations with law enforcement [6]. Group 2: Political Responses - Following the unrest, President Trump softened his stance, appointing Tom Homan to manage immigration enforcement in Minnesota, while the previous commander was reassigned [8]. - The Department of Homeland Security labeled the second victim, Pretti, as a "domestic terrorist," further escalating public outrage and protests against federal enforcement actions [7]. - Prominent political figures, including former Presidents Obama and Clinton, condemned the actions of immigration enforcement, while Biden called for a thorough investigation into the incidents [7]. Group 3: Enforcement Tactics and Leadership - The enforcement tactics employed by the officers, referred to as "Bovino tactics," have been criticized for their aggressiveness, contributing to the violent outcomes in Minneapolis [10]. - Gregory Bovino, the former commander of the enforcement actions, has faced backlash for his approach, which has been described as overly aggressive and theatrical [11]. - The ongoing situation has led to calls for the resignation of key officials, including Homeland Security Secretary Mayorkas, amid accusations of mismanagement and failure to ensure accountability [8].
